    Tips in general, little discussion , just the tips,

    Tip one: a good smear of grease on the tap flutes will hold/retain most of the tapping chips Tip two: Zip-lock bags Sharpy marked make a decent small or any parts for OK safe storage. Tip three: Hold your scale on an angle, or straight edge and look past to something straight or horizontal to...
